Sideroflexin-5 is a member of the Sideroflexin (SFXN) family, which consists of highly conserved multi-spanning transmembrane proteins mainly located in the mitochondrial inner membrane. SFXN5 is primarily characterized as a mitochondrial amino-acid transporter and mediator of citrate transmembrane transport. It does not function as a serine transporter, unlike some other family members (e.g., SFXN1). In brown adipose tissue, SFXN5 may regulate thermogenesis by supporting mitochondrial glycerol-3-phosphate utilization. Current research links the SFXN family to essential metabolic processes such as iron uptake, redox balance, and amino acid metabolism, but SFXN5 remains the least well-studied member. Disease associations include mitochondrial deficiency syndromes and possible roles in neurodegenerative and cancer processes, based on emerging expression data and known implications from other family members. There are currently no approved drugs targeting SFXN5 directly, nor is it an established biomarker or well-defined safety target.
